Hi, I have a 97 cadillac deville with custom rims and bad tires. I also own a parted out 98 camaro with stock rims and good tires.

my question is, can i switch out these rims so i dont have to buy expensive low profile tires or wil this cause problems. they both have five lug nuts and they seem to measure the same space apart.

No.

The rim offset is almost certainly different. Domestic FWD cars almost always have more rim negative offset than RWD cars. So evem if the bolt holes are the same, there will be clearance and handling issues.
